Code § 5123.1613","heading":"Guardian supported living exclusion.","body":"(A) A person who has been granted guardianship of an individual with a developmental disability shall not provide supported living to that individual either as an independent provider or as an employee or contractor of a supported living certificate holder unless there is a relationship by blood, adoption, or marriage between the guardian and the individual.\n(B) A supported living certificate holder owned or operated by a guardian of an individual with a developmental disability shall not provide supported living to that individual unless there is a relationship by blood, adoption, or marriage between the guardian and the individual.","path":["Title 51 Public Welfare","Chapter 5123 Department of Developmental Disabilities"],"source_url":"https://codes.ohio.gov/ohio-revised-code/section-5123.1613","current_through":"2025-09-30 (House Bill 96 - 136th General Assembly)","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T19:24:39Z","sha256":"cd29835488575b9e5e01813c89ce80e1613f0b37525a07111ac0cd958a4cbf7f","source_id":"us-oh","stale":false,"prev":"us-oh/ohio-rev.-code-5123.1612","next":"us-oh/ohio-rev.-code-5123.17"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
